C# Program to Show the Use of Exists Property

DirectoryInfo class provides different types of methods and properties for creating, moving, deleting, renaming, and modifying directories and subdirectories. Exists property is the property of DirectoryInfo class. This property is used to check whether a directory exists or not and return the boolean value accordingly. It will return true if the directory exists, otherwise, it will return false. It will also return if any error occurs while determining if the file exists, or if the specified file is missing, or if the caller does not get permission to read the specified file.
Syntax:
bool DirectoryInfo.Exists
Example:
C#
using System;
using System.IO;
class GFG{
static void Main()
{
DirectoryInfo information = new DirectoryInfo( "sravan_directory" );
if (information.Exists)
Console.WriteLine( "Exists" );
else
Console.WriteLine( "Not Exists" );
}
}

Output:
Not Exists
